Appeal refused for murderer

The Fiji Court of Appeal has refused the appeal of Bernard Hicks who is serving jail term for a count of murder.

Hicks was produced before Fiji Court of Appeal Judge Justice Chandana Prematilaka.

The appeal was filed outside the time frame.

Hicks who murdered his 33-year-old defacto wife, was sentenced to life imprisonment in 2016.

He had filed an appeal against his sentence and conviction.

He has to serve 16 years in jail after which he can request for a presidential pardon.

Hicks stabbed his defacto wife 8 times at an apartment in Suva after an argument.
